In a study conducted in China by researchers at Tsinghua University in Beijing, sugar– Sweetened Beverages (SSB) are the highest among the 13-29 year old age group. “As a major dietary source of added sugars, SSB may be a potential risk factor for the male pattern. hair loss‘ said the study.
From January to April 2022, researchers observed more than 1,028 Chinese men between the ages of 18 and 45 to determine their self-reported lifestyle habits and hair lossOf these, hair loss problems were found to be common in 30% of men with a habit of drinking at least one sugary drink.
They conclude: SSB consumption more likely to report male pattern baldness. ”
They are, sugary drinks Hair loss in men needs to be confirmed by additional studies, as epidemiological studies on the association between the two are still inadequate.
